"Helldivers 2 CEO Addresses Server Capacity Issues and Player Behavior"

TL;DR Summary
The CEO of Arrowhead Game Studios, Johan Pilestedt, addressed player concerns about server capacity issues for Helldivers 2, explaining that the problem isn't simply solved by buying more servers but requires backend code optimization. He emphasized the need to give the developers space to work on the issue without added pressure. Pilestedt also admitted that offering double XP to make up for server overloading may not have been the best idea, as it led to further server crowding. Despite technical challenges, the game's popularity continues to soar on Steam, breaking its peak concurrent player record.
